CQ Researcher http://library.cqpress.com/cqresearcher Well-researched in-depth analysis reporting on the most current and controversial topics issues of today. Produced by Congressional Quarterly, each article contains an abstract, overview, background, current situation, outlook, special focus, chronology, pros and cons, extensive bibliography, and footnotes. Click on each component separately or go to PDF to get entire article.

Salem Health http://health.salempress.com Salem Health draws from Magill's Medical Guide, which covers diseases, disorders, treatments, procedures, specialties, anatomy, biology, and issues in an A-Z format. It includes sidebars addressing recent developments in medicine and concise information boxes for all diseases and disorders.
